Yun’e Zeng is a scholar working on Analytical Chemistry,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Yun’e Zeng has authored 70 papers receiving a total of 915 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 27 papers in Analytical Chemistry, 24 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 22 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Yun’e Zeng’s work include Analytical chemistry methods development (24 papers), Electrochemical sensors and biosensors (21 papers) and DNA and Nucleic Acid Chemistry (11 papers). Yun’e Zeng is often cited by papers focused on Analytical chemistry methods development (24 papers), Electrochemical sensors and biosensors (21 papers) and DNA and Nucleic Acid Chemistry (11 papers). Yun’e Zeng collaborates with scholars based in China, Japan and United States. Yun’e Zeng's co-authors include Zhike He, Heyou Han, Zucheng Jiang, Hui Meng, Bin Hu, Liansheng Ling, Gongwu Song, Ruxiu Cai, Liangjie Yuan and Jiming Hu and has published in prestigious journals such as Food Chemistry, Journal of Chromatography A and Analytica Chimica Acta.
